Kitty Piercy is an American politician who served as the Mayor of Eugene, Oregon, from 2005 to 2017. Prior to her mayoral tenure, she was a member of the Oregon House of Representatives, representing House District 39 from 1995 to 2000, where she served as the Minority Leader. Throughout her career, Piercy has been a prominent advocate for environmental sustainability and climate change mitigation, notably signing the US Mayors Climate Protection Agreement and establishing the Eugene Sustainability Commission. Her political career is marked by her focus on regional transit infrastructure and local governance initiatives.
